Recent golf results

From valley courses


Here are some golf results from local matches in August.


At Bigwood Golf

A total 72 ladies competed in the 18-hole Bigwood Golf Course Ladies Invitational tournament Aug. 12. A special thanks went out to hole sponsors and Peggy G for their help.

Results by flight:

A Flight—Low gross: Terry Tracy and Kathy Hanchett 74. Low net: Janet Cantor and Pat McGinnis 59; Judy Prairie and Shauna Robinson 60.

B Flight—Low gross: Torene Bonner and Patti Gordon 75; Joanne Wetherell and Candy Ryan 76. Low net: Susan Reitsma and Jeanette Johnson 52; Janice Larsen and Patti Hapayen 56.

C Flight—Low gross: Bev Pickering and Bonnie Bruce 87; Cindy Fabian and Louise Cooley 91. Low net: Barbara Gott and Dee Gott 62; Jill Rubin and Sharon Bridge 63; Betty Karlson and Nanette Woodland 63.

D Flight—Low gross: Kay Bengochea and Vicki Jarvis 94. Low net: Peggy Guerecaechevarria and Jan Jones 57; Mary Thiessen and Carmen Moore 60; Vi Croshaw and Shirley Ridgeway 61.


At Valley Club

The Valley Club staged its Wildflower Invitational Aug. 14-15. Here are results by flight:

Overall net winners were Helga Fast and Liz David with a 126. The gross stroke winners, also in the Larkspur Flight, were Barb Smith and Jean Smith with a 142.

Larkspur Flight—Gross: 2—Scoti Carden and Jen Harper 143. 3—Sally Darmody and Gloria Sage 152. 4—Jan Wygle and Judith Hinds 154. Net: 2—Mary Kay Davis and Debbie Exley 130. 3—Jeanne Landreth and Laurie Howard 133. 4—Diane McDonald and Linda Suddock 135.

Fireweed Flight—Gross: 1—Judy Atkinson and Beckie Biedebach 170. 2—Ursula Hinson and Jeanine Burns 171. 3—Betsy Manchester and Margo Rogers 174; Susan Lovett and Sue Blankenbiker 174. Net: 1—Kingsley Croul and Ruth Walsh 130. 2—Gay Emery and Bonnie Hutchinson 134. 3—Barb Shelton and Kaye Burnham 134. 4—Carole Almond and Shelly Arbuckle 135.

Syringa Flight—Gross: 1—Sherry Propst and Molly Campbell 179. 2—Joann Stevens and Casey Wechsler 184. 3—Claire Bailey and Nancy Winton 187. 4—Heather Flynn and Torene Bonner 192. Net: 1—Wendy Pesky and Penny Coe 128; Louise Cooley and Cindy Fabian 128. 3—Milo Sendin and Herma Altshule 135. 4—Julie Shultz and Mollie McCain 140.

Long drive winners were Scoti Carden, Kathy Kolar, Claire Bailey, Liz David, Julie Shultz and Cindy Fabian.

Putting contest winners were Gay Emery, Emily Garr, Scoti Carden, Jean Smith, Sandra Fisher, Bonnie Hutchinson, Jeanne Landreth and Kathy Kolar.


Valley Club Member-Guest

The Valley Club’s Couples Member-Guest tournament wrapped up Monday.

First flight—Gross: 1—Barry Luboviski, Jan Wygle, Judy Hinds, Al Hinds. Net: 1—Dave Almond, Carole Almond, Hugh VanDeventer, Phyllis VanDeventer. 2—Dick Shelton, Barb Shelton, Rod Sievers, Deborah Sievers. 3—Bob Cline, Roz Cline, Fritz Hoffman, Marilyn Hoffman.

Second flight—Gross: 1—Richard Emery, Gay Emery, Brian Moss, Carole Moss. Net: 1—Bill Gault, Nancy Crandall, Carl Harris, Patti Harris. 2—John Blattman, Betty Blattman, Don Brewer, Connie Brewer. 3—Dave Rice, Mimi Rice, Steve Stroh, Kas Stroh.
